Co5 Units Run Large Brush Fire in Huntingtown

November 26, 2016

Around 0630, Calvert Control Center alerted numerous companies surrounding Huntingtown, of a large brush fire on Robinson Rd that Co6 was on scene of already.

Co5 units including E51(5 personnel), TN5(2 personnel), BX5(2 personnel), BR5(2 personnel), & Chief 5 all marked up within minutes of dispatch to respond on the incident.

All Co5 units reported to the "Southside" location of the fire to assist in operations. Chief 5 worked with E51 & BR5 on establishing a water supply plan to fill Tankers and Brush Trucks out of a large pond on the farm property.

With multiple units in the woods, E12 & BR5 pulled drafts on their respective apparatus to fill any unit that was in need.

E51 & TN5 cleared the scene around 0830, while BR5, BX5 & Chief 5 remained on scene to help finish operations with units still on scene until approimately 1100 hrs.

Units: E51, TN5, BX5, BR5, & Chief 5
 
Mutual Aid: Co1, Co2, Co3, Co6, Co7, Charles Co.5, Charles Co.2
